Research on Decision-Making for Renewal of Power Grid Equipment Based on Comprehensive Performance Evaluation

Abstract:

Aims to develop a scientific and rational decision-making method for power grid equipment renewal to achieve the healthy and sustainable operation of power grid enterprises.Basing on the theory of total life cycle cost (LCC),the Weibull model is introduced to calculate costs,and the time value of money is incorporatd to establish an optimization model.Thereby the optimal economic life and the minimum total life cycle cost are derived.A comprehensive performance evaluation system is constructed from the perspectives of economy,technology,and safety.It covers six indicators such as total life cycle cost and availability.The indicators are quantified through the Analytic Hierarchy Process (AHP) and normalization.Taking the communication line equipment of Company A as an example,the number of the renewal equipment is reduced by 329 km compared with the expected amount,and the equipment renewal budget is decreased by 26.45%.The results show that the proposed model effectively reduces the operating costs of power grid enterprises and enhances the comprehensive performance of the equipment,providing strong support for the equipment renewal decisions.

Key words: power equipment, total life cycle cost, comprehensive performance, equipment renewal decision
